The cheapest way to get from Johannesburg Park Station to Port Alfred is to car train and drive which costs R 850 - R 1 400 and takes 19h 32m.
The fastest way to get from Johannesburg Park Station to Port Alfred is to fly and taxi which takes 3h 10m and costs R 2 200 - R 3 900.
The distance between Johannesburg Park Station and Port Alfred is 922 km. The road distance is 1030.4 km.
The best way to get from Johannesburg Park Station to Port Alfred without a car is to bus and taxi which takes 14h 41m and costs R 1 100 - R 1 500.
It takes approximately 3h 10m to get from Johannesburg Park Station to Port Alfred,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Johannesburg Park Station to Port Alfred is 1030 km. It takes approximately 12h 2m to drive from Johannesburg Park Station to Port Alfred.

There is no direct connection from Johannesburg Park Station to Port Alfred. However, you can take the taxi to Johannesburg-Airport-JNB airport, fly to East London (ELS), then take the taxi to Port Alfred. Alternatively, you can walk to Johannesburg, take the bus to Grahamstown, then take the taxi to Port Alfred.
